Barn Gutter Repair in Longmont, CO
Barn gutter repair services address issues related to damaged, clogged, or improperly functioning gutters on residential properties. This includes fixing leaks, replacing sections of damaged guttering, realigning misaligned components, and ensuring that downspouts are clear and correctly positioned. Property owners typically request gutter repair when experiencing water overflow, visible damage after storms, or signs of deterioration such as rust, sagging, or cracks. Understanding the extent of damage and the specific areas needing attention helps homeowners determine whether rep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ement might be necessary.
Before requesting gutter repair services, property owners should assess the overall condition of their gutters and identify any specific concerns, such as persistent leaks or blockages. It's also helpful to know the age of the gutter system and the type of material used, as these factors influence repair options and longevity. Clear communication about the problem areas and any previous issues can assist in planning effective repairs, ensuring the gutter system functions properly to protect the property from water damage.

Common Barn Gutter Repair Jobs
Gutter leak repairs - fixing leaks to prevent water damage and foundation issues.
Gutter cleaning services - removing debris to ensure proper water flow and prevent clogs.
Gutter downspout repair - restoring downspouts to direct water away from the foundation effectively.
Gutter section replacement - replacing damaged or rusted sections for continued functionality.
Gutter sealing and waterproofing - applying sealants to prevent leaks and extend gutter lifespan.
Gutter alignment and adjustment - ensuring gutters are properly pitched for optimal water drainage.
Barn Gutter Repair Questions
What are common signs of gutter damage? Visible sagging, leaks, or overflowing water near the foundation may indicate gutter issues needing repair.
Why is gutter repair important for property owners? Properly functioning gutters help prevent water damage, foundation issues, and landscape erosion around the property.
What types of gutter repairs are typically requested? Repairs often include fixing leaks, sealing joint connections, replacing damaged sections, and realigning gutters.
How can I maintain my gutters between repairs? Regular removal of debris and checking for blockages can help maintain proper water flow and prevent damage.
